The top Republicans on House committees next year will include a double-amputee Afghanistan veteran and a member of the Chickasaw Nation.
But almost certainly no women.
House Republicans’ Steering Committee selected chairmen for the high-profile Energy and Commerce and Foreign Affairs committees earlier this week. Tomorrow they’ll reconvene to decide competitive elections to lead panels including Financial Services. But after the one Republican woman seeking a contested gavel lost her battle, there’s virtually no path for a steering-selected committee chairwoman in the 119th Congress.
